Revisiting the T2K data using different models for the neutrino-nucleus cross sections

We present a three-flavour fit to the recent \nu\mu --> \nu e and \nu\mu --> \nu\mu T2K oscillation data with different models for the neutrino-nucleus cross section. We show that, even for a limited statistics, the allowed regions and best fit points in the (\theta_{13},\delta_{CP}) and (\theta_{23},\Delta m^2_{atm}) planes are affected if, instead of using the Fermi Gas model to describe the quasielastic cross section, we employ a model including the multinucleon emission channel.
